About this property
3a Childs Yard, Southwold
This idyllic bolt hole is a hidden gem in the heart of Southwold and offers the perfect blend of tranquillity and convenience. Tucked away behind the high street, just a stone’s throw from the pubs, restaurants, sandy beach, iconic pier and the beach hut lined promenade, this one bedroom, first floor apartment has been renovated to the highest standard and provides bright comfortable accommodation for a couple or a single guest (not forgetting the dog !)
As you enter, stairs lead up to the light and airy apartment.
To the right is the fully equipped kitchen with integrated dishwasher, fridge with small freezer compartment, 4 ring hob and oven, microwave, kettle, and toaster.
The generous sized lounge has a 3-seater sofa, a large, buttoned footrest / table, dining table and chairs and a Smart TV. Windows look out onto the high street.
The spacious bedroom as a king size bed, double chest of drawers and 2 bedside tables. Windows look out onto the high street
The bathroom has a shower cubicle with a waterfall shower and a handheld shower, WC, hand basin and heated towel rail.
There is also a bright and airy dressing room with a hanging rail, dressing table and chair and a large mirror.
